Quinta do Lago Series – Laranjal Sunday 9th June 2013

Set in a valley of orange groves behind the Quinta do Lago resort, this beautiful golf course was the setting for this week’s Chez Carlos Golf Society outing.  Those who had played the course previously were loud in its praise before we started and those who had not were similarly impressed afterwards.

IMG_20130609_085148

The course meanders through parkland with sufficient trees to cause problems for the stray shot, but sparse enough to allow a recovery.  Similarly there is just enough well placed water to make several holes memorable for their design and testing to play.  The greens were fast and true with subtle borrows to make them a test for even the best of putters.  The rest of us just had to accept what happened!  The course was immaculately presented and the staff were friendly, courteous and efficient.  This is a lovely golf course.

Scoring on the whole was excellent with 9 players scoring in the 30’s.  The winner though was David Exley with 38 points, 19 on each 9.  Second place went to Peter Bell with 37 points, who benefitted from his new “official” handicap of 20.  In 3rd place was Nuno Louro with 36, including 22 on the outward 9 where he holed putts from vast distances much to his delight!  Unfortunately the back 9 proved more difficult.IMG_20130609_092533

There were two nearest the pin prizes this week and selecting from the 5 par 3’s was difficult as none is shorter than 155 meters.  Hole 3 was perhaps the most straightforward and Bob Guard won the bottle of wine with a fine shot to within 3 meters.  The testing 11 at 170 metres proved more difficult with Neil Rogerson pipping Ron McLachlan by a few centimeters, but still some way from the flag.

Carlos had two special prizes which were drawn from all the cards, the first a 1 hour physiotherapy massage was won by David Exley, and the second – a free entry to the next match in the series at Quinta North – was won by Peter Bell.  First and second again!

Afterwards we were treated to a superb lunch and wine back at Chez Carlos restaurant.  Thanks go to Felipe and all his staff for their food and their service.  Thanks too to Carlos for organizing such a great day at a truly remarkable value .

Quinta Do Lago South has hosted the Portuguese Open eight times. In 1989, Colin Montgomerie won his first European Tour event here by an impressive 11 strokes, set a course record of 63 and a Tour record of 24 under par. The course is laid out on beautiful undulating terrain with shady umbrella pines and a few man-made lakes that attract many aquatic bird species. The signature hole is the scenic par-3 15th (160mts) with a long carry over a lake to the green set amongst pine trees. Quinta Do Vale – Saturday 3rd December. Weekly Competition

The Quinta do Vale, designed by Seve Ballesteros with 6 Par-5’s, 6 Par-4’s and 6 Par-3’s with stunning views over the Guadiana River to Spain this is no push over and when the wind blows it is up there with the hardest courses to play – no +40pts on this track! It has been over two years since the Society had played here so a visit was long overdue.

Millionaire’s golf would have a been a fair description today. No one ahead of us or behind, a manicured course with superb greens under clear blue skies and sun and all for the Society price of 29€.
